The United States XRF Lead-Based Paint Analyzer Market size was valued at USD 150 million in 2022 and is projected to reach USD 210 million by 2030, growing at a CAGR of 4.5% from 2024 to 2030.
The United States XRF (X-ray fluorescence) lead-based paint analyzer market is experiencing significant growth due to rising concerns about lead exposure in residential and commercial buildings. These analyzers offer fast and non-destructive testing, allowing for the detection of lead-based paint in older structures. The market is primarily driven by stringent government regulations regarding lead-based paint in homes and the increasing need for environmental safety. Additionally, the demand for portable and easy-to-use devices is boosting market expansion. As the importance of lead-free environments grows, technological advancements in XRF analyzers are also fueling market progress. With heightened awareness of public health, the market is expected to see further growth in the coming years. The increasing adoption of XRF analyzers by contractors, regulatory bodies, and inspection firms is contributing to the market's expansion. Key players in the industry are continuously innovating to improve the accuracy and efficiency of their products.

Despite the positive outlook for the United States XRF lead-based paint analyzer market, certain factors may impede its growth. The high cost of advanced analyzers can deter smaller companies or individuals from adopting the technology. Additionally, while XRF analyzers offer great accuracy, they may still face challenges in detecting very low levels of lead in certain paints. The regulatory environment, though supportive, can also create barriers, as certain regions may have different compliance standards. Moreover, the lack of proper training and expertise in using these analyzers may limit their effectiveness, especially among non-professionals. These restraints can limit the market's potential unless addressed by the industry.

In the United States, the XRF lead-based paint analyzer market is expected to witness significant growth across different regions. The highest demand is anticipated in regions with older housing stocks, such as the Northeast and Midwest, where lead-based paints were more commonly used in the past. Regulatory requirements in states like California, New York, and Illinois further contribute to the demand for these analyzers. Additionally, increased awareness about the health risks associated with lead exposure in these regions is pushing the adoption of XRF technology. As renovation activities increase, especially in older buildings, the market is also likely to grow in the South and West regions. Regional policies and safety concerns continue to play a key role in shaping market dynamics.
